## Cold Starts, Quickly

Welcome to the Fennelcloud plugin program! One thing that trips up new authors: our serverless handlers go cold after about ten minutes of inactivity, so your first invocation can take a couple of seconds while the runtime warms up. Don't panic, and don't add retry storms — just budget for it in your timeouts. Keep your init code lean and lazy-load anything heavy. To publish a warmed-handler plugin to the gallery, you'll sign your bundle with the key below.

rollout seal: bky9_PeXH1fTLY

**Meeting Notes — Metrology Transfer (excerpt)**

The batch of calibration weights from the Dunmarsh lab is cased, certified, and ready for the Tuesday run to the receiving site at Oxhollow. Weights must stay upright; no stacking. Receiving staff should verify the case count against the certificate on arrival. The courier hand-over instruction is noted below.

handover note for yagef-bagep: the drudor pelius courier leaves the kasdor zorvan norir ledger at gate 8016 under passcode 755406

**Mgmt Meeting Minutes — Retiring the Brightline Range**

Quick recap for sales leads at Fenholt Supplies: we agreed to retire the Brightline fixture range by year-end. Remaining stock moves to clearance pricing next month, and accounts on standing orders get migrated to the Lumetta range. Trade-in incentives were approved in principle. The confidential note on next steps sits just below.

board note of bajof-bajeg: The pricing group signed off on a budget of $13.4 million for Project Sildor. The renewal with Lamixek Holdings closes at $48.9 million a year, 49 percent above the last contract.